Samsung starts mass production of 16Gb GDDR6 chips
Published in Graphics


Based on 10nm-class manufacturing process

Samsung has announced that it has started mass production of 16Gb GDDR6 memory chips, offering twice the speed and density levels compared to currently available GDDR5 memory chips.

Intel and Micron end partnership
Published in News


Thanks for the memories

Intel and Micron are to pull the plug on their long-running partnership on 3D NAND flash memory by early next year.
